CVD (Chemical Vapor Deposition) SiC Focus Rings play a critical role in semiconductor manufacturing by ensuring precise plasma confinement, uniform etching performance, and extended equipment lifespan. Their exceptional thermal stability, corrosion resistance, and low particle generation characteristics make them indispensable in advanced chip production environments, particularly for leading-edge logic, memory, and power semiconductor devices.

Semiconductor Industry Expansion Drives Market Growth
The global semiconductor industry continues to invest heavily in new fabrication facilities and advanced manufacturing nodes. As semiconductor manufacturers transition toward smaller process geometries and more complex chip architectures, the need for highly durable and contamination-resistant chamber components has increased significantly.
CVD SiC Focus Rings are increasingly preferred over conventional materials due to their superior plasma resistance and longer operational lifespan. The growth of artificial intelligence, high-performance computing, electric vehicles, 5G infrastructure, and advanced consumer electronics is further boosting wafer production volumes, creating strong demand for precision semiconductor processing components.
Industry analysts indicate that Asia-Pacific remains the largest consumer of semiconductor manufacturing equipment, accounting for a substantial share of global demand for CVD SiC focus rings due to the concentration of wafer fabrication facilities in China, Taiwan, South Korea, and Japan.
